国外低代码平台趟过那些坑
低代码平台是一种快速开发应用程序的工具,它可以帮助开发人员在减少编码工作的同时提高开发效率。在国外,低代码平台已经成为许多企业的首选,但在使用过程中,也会遇到一些挑战和坑。本文将介绍一些国外低代码平台的常见问题,并提供解决方案。
首先,一个常见的问题是平台的可扩展性。虽然低代码平台可以快速构建应用程序,但在应对大规模项目或复杂业务需求时,可能会遇到扩展性问题。为了解决这个问题,开发人员应该选择一个具有良好扩展性的低代码平台,例如支持自定义插件或模块化开发的平台。这样可以确保在项目的不断发展中,能够满足新的需求。
其次,安全性是另一个需要考虑的问题。由于低代码平台通常提供了许多预定义的组件和功能,可能存在安全漏洞。为了确保应用程序的安全性,开发人员应该定期更新平台的版本,并及时修复已知的安全问题。此外,还应该采取额外的安全措施,例如对用户输入进行验证和过滤,以防止潜在的攻击。
另一个需要注意的问题是平台的可定制性。有些低代码平台可能提供了很多预定义的模板和组件,但在某些情况下,这些模板和组件可能无法满足特定的业务需求。为了解决这个问题,开发人员应该选择一个具有高度可定制性的低代码平台,例如支持自定义代码和样式的平台。这样可以确保应用程序能够根据实际需求进行定制和扩展。
此外,平台的性能也是一个需要考虑的问题。由于低代码平台通常会生成大量的代码和脚本,可能会导致应用程序的性能下降。为了提高性能,开发人员应该优化代码和脚本,减少不必要的计算和网络请求。另外,选择一个具有良好性能的低代码平台也是很重要的。
最后,一个常见的问题是平台的学习曲线。由于低代码平台通常具有自己的开发语言和工具,开发人员可能需要一定的时间来学习和适应平台。为了缩短学习曲线,开发人员可以参考平台的文档和教程,或者参加培训课程。此外,与其他开发人员和社区成员交流经验也是很有帮助的。
总之,国外的低代码平台在快速开发应用程序方面具有很大的优势,但在使用过程中也会遇到一些挑战和坑。通过选择具有良好扩展性、安全性、可定制性和性能的平台,并充分利用平台的学习资源,开发人员可以更好地应对这些问题,并提高开发效率。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。